NAD: A Key Player in Cellular Function
NAD is a vital molecule that exists in two forms: NAD+ and NADH. It serves as an electron carrier in the mitochondria, the powerhouse of the cell, where it participates in the production of ATP, the energy currency of the body. As such, NAD+ is essential for various cellular processes, including DNA repair, gene expression, and cellular signaling.
The Role of NAD+ in Muscle Growth
Research suggests that NAD+ levels decline with age, which can lead to a decrease in muscle mass and strength. By supplementing with NAD+, it is believed that muscle growth can be promoted. Here’s how:
1. Enhanced Mitochondrial Function: NAD+ helps improve mitochondrial function, leading to increased ATP production. This can result in better energy levels during workouts, enabling individuals to push their limits and stimulate muscle growth.
2. DNA Repair: NAD+ is crucial for DNA repair, which is essential for muscle recovery and growth. By maintaining healthy DNA, NAD+ can help reduce the risk of muscle damage and promote faster healing.
3. Cellular Signaling: NAD+ plays a role in cellular signaling pathways that regulate muscle growth. By supporting these pathways, NAD+ may help stimulate muscle hypertrophy.
Supplementing with NAD+ for Muscle Growth
While NAD+ is naturally present in the body, its levels can be supplemented through various means, including:
1. NAD+ Supplements: There are several NAD+ supplements available on the market, such as nicotinamide riboside (NR) and nicotinamide mononucleotide (NMN). These supplements are believed to increase NAD+ levels in the body.
2. NAD+ Precursors: Foods rich in NAD+ precursors, such as nuts, seeds, and green vegetables, can also help maintain healthy NAD+ levels.
3. Exercise: Regular exercise can stimulate NAD+ production in the body, contributing to muscle growth and recovery.
